linux (4.3.0-5.14) xenial; urgency=low

  [ Andy Whitcroft ]

  * Release Tracking Bug
    - LP: #1526295
  * [Config] disable CONFIG_ARM64_LSE_ATOMICS to avoid issues with ARMv8.1
    support in latest compilers
  * [Config] disable CONFIG_CRYPTO_AES_ARM64_CE* to avoid issues with
    ARMv8.1 support in latest compilers
  * [Config] ignore modules for armhf as we lose a bunch of broken snd-*
    modules

  [ Tim Gardner ]

  * [Config] Add s390 modules to nic-modules udeb
    - LP: #1525297
  * [Config] update configs after v4.3.3

  [ Upstream Kernel Changes ]

  * Revert "ipv6: ndisc: inherit metadata dst when creating ndisc requests"
  * powerpc/tm: Check for already reclaimed tasks
    - LP: #1520411
  * powerpc/tm: Block signal return setting invalid MSR state
    - LP: #1520411
  * certs: add .gitignore to stop git nagging about x509_certificate_list
  * r8169: fix kasan reported skb use-after-free.
  * af-unix: fix use-after-free with concurrent readers while splicing
  * af_unix: don't append consumed skbs to sk_receive_queue
  * af_unix: take receive queue lock while appending new skb
  * unix: avoid use-after-free in ep_remove_wait_queue
  * af-unix: passcred support for sendpage
  * ipv6: Avoid creating RTF_CACHE from a rt that is not managed by fib6
    tree
  * ipv6: Check expire on DST_NOCACHE route
  * ipv6: Check rt->dst.from for the DST_NOCACHE route
  * tools/net: Use include/uapi with __EXPORTED_HEADERS__
  * packet: do skb_probe_transport_header when we actually have data
  * packet: always probe for transport header
  * packet: only allow extra vlan len on ethernet devices
  * packet: infer protocol from ethernet header if unset
  * packet: fix tpacket_snd max frame len
  * sctp: translate host order to network order when setting a hmacid
  * net/mlx5e: Added self loopback prevention
  * net/mlx4_core: Fix sleeping while holding spinlock at
    rem_slave_counters
  * ip_tunnel: disable preemption when updating per-cpu tstats
  * net: switchdev: fix return code of fdb_dump stub
  * net: thunder: Check for driver data in nicvf_remove()
  * snmp: Remove duplicate OUTMCAST stat increment
  * net/ip6_tunnel: fix dst leak
  * net: qmi_wwan: add XS Stick W100-2 from 4G Systems
  * tcp: md5: fix lockdep annotation
  * tcp: disable Fast Open on timeouts after handshake
  * tcp: fix potential huge kmalloc() calls in TCP_REPAIR
  * tcp: initialize tp->copied_seq in case of cross SYN connection
  * net, scm: fix PaX detected msg_controllen overflow in scm_detach_fds
  * net: ipmr: fix static mfc/dev leaks on table destruction
  * net: ip6mr: fix static mfc/dev leaks on table destruction
  * vrf: fix double free and memory corruption on register_netdevice
    failure
  * broadcom: fix PHY_ID_BCM5481 entry in the id table
  * tipc: fix error handling of expanding buffer headroom
  * ipv6: distinguish frag queues by device for multicast and link-local
    packets
  * bpf, array: fix heap out-of-bounds access when updating elements
  * ipv6: add complete rcu protection around np->opt
  * net/neighbour: fix crash at dumping device-agnostic proxy entries
  * ipv6: sctp: implement sctp_v6_destroy_sock()
  * openvswitch: fix hangup on vxlan/gre/geneve device deletion
  * net_sched: fix qdisc_tree_decrease_qlen() races
  * btrfs: fix resending received snapshot with parent
  * Btrfs: fix file corruption and data loss after cloning inline extents
  * Btrfs: fix regression when running delayed references
  * Btrfs: fix race leading to incorrect item deletion when dropping
    extents
  * Btrfs: fix race leading to BUG_ON when running delalloc for nodatacow
  * Btrfs: fix race when listing an inode's xattrs
  * btrfs: fix signed overflows in btrfs_sync_file
  * rbd: don't put snap_context twice in rbd_queue_workfn()
  * ext4 crypto: fix memory leak in ext4_bio_write_page()
  * ext4 crypto: fix bugs in ext4_encrypted_zeroout()
  * ext4: fix potential use after free in __ext4_journal_stop
  * ext4, jbd2: ensure entering into panic after recording an error in
    superblock
  * firewire: ohci: fix JMicron JMB38x IT context discovery
  * nfsd: serialize state seqid morphing operations
  * nfsd: eliminate sending duplicate and repeated delegations
  * debugfs: fix refcount imbalance in start_creating
  * nfs4: start callback_ident at idr 1
  * nfs4: resend LAYOUTGET when there is a race that changes the seqid
  * nfs: if we have no valid attrs, then don't declare the attribute cache
    valid
  * ocfs2: fix umask ignored issue
  * block: fix segment split
  * ceph: fix message length computation
  * ALSA: pci: depend on ZONE_DMA
  * ALSA: hda/hdmi - apply Skylake fix-ups to Broxton display codec
  * cobalt: fix Kconfig dependency
  * Btrfs: fix regression running delayed references when using qgroups
  * Linux 4.3.3
